p1009 is for variable valvetiming control this code is usually caused by a low oil level condition. This code also can be caused by dirty oil or even the wrong oil viscosity. It is very important to keep regular oil changes on any vehicle with variable valve timing to avoid big dollar repairs later.

P1457
Description Evaporative emission (EVAP) canister purge system (canister system) vent solenoid blocked or restricted.
There is a manufacturer's service bulletin regarding this very DTC.
An upgraded hose kit is available from Honda to fix the problem.
Unless you're an advanced DIYer, I'd find someone that can do this repair for you.
